I applied through a recruiter.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at Stanhope Capital (London, England) in Mar 2018
Interview
- Good contact with the Partner I met. She shown a strong wish to find the right person for the offered job who could fit with the spirit of her team but also huge desire to be sure the job will be the right move for the applicant.
She has made very clear and transparent her expectation from the new team member, the career path opportunities and what the day-to-day job would look like short/med and long term. She also communicates openly about what the ''life within the team and the company'' would look like.
- the Partner is seeking for long term professional partnership so that clients can benefit from stable and dedicated relationship over the years
- Positive interaction with two additional Partners during the first and the second interview, which gave me the opportunity to understand better the structure of Stanhope but also gave me a picture of the work environment.
They expressed a real interested in attracting talents and ambitious candidates to expand the business and to strenghten client high quality services.
I declined the third interview planned because I decided Stanhope/this position was not the right move for me at this stage of my career however I must commend the Partner I met for her candour and the utmost professionalism she has demonstrated to me.
